Enterprise Architecture

An Enterprise Architecture (EA) is a conceptual blueprint that defines the structure (IT assets) and operation (business processes) of the organization and, from that outset, analyzes how the organization can effectively achieve its current and future objectives. This conceptual blueprint will help multiple departments understand the broader business model and articulate challenges and business risks.

This course explores EA terminology through the TOGAF Standard and enables you to better participate in EA discussions.
